Low Power Mode and Battery Optimization Tips for Every Device
Extending battery life reduces charging frequency, which reduces energy consumption and extends battery lifespan. Here are the settings that matter most on every device.

Every charge cycle degrades a lithium battery slightly. By reducing the number of times you charge your devices — through power optimization and smart habits — you both save energy and extend the usable lifespan of every battery-powered device you own.
iPhone Battery Optimization
Optimized Battery Charging: Settings > Battery > Battery Health & Charging > Optimized Battery Charging. This learns your charging routine and delays charging past 80% until you need it, reducing time spent at 100% (which degrades batteries faster).
Low Power Mode: Settings > Battery > Low Power Mode. Reduces background activity, mail fetch, visual effects, and some downloads. Extends battery life by 20-30%. Enable it when below 30% or whenever you need to stretch a charge.
Screen brightness: The display is the largest single power consumer. Reduce brightness to the minimum comfortable level (30-40% in indoor environments). Auto-Brightness (Settings > Accessibility > Display & Text Size) adjusts automatically.
Background app refresh: Settings > General > Background App Refresh. Disable for apps that do not need to update in the background. Social media apps, news apps, and email can refresh when you open them rather than constantly in the background.
Android Battery Optimization
Adaptive Battery: Settings > Battery > Adaptive Battery. Android learns which apps you use least and restricts their background activity. Keep this enabled.
Battery Saver: Android's equivalent of Low Power Mode. Restricts background activity, visual effects, and location services. Can be set to activate automatically at a configurable battery percentage.
Dark mode: On OLED screens (most modern Android phones), dark mode reduces display power consumption by 30-50%. Dark pixels on OLED are truly off, drawing zero power.
Laptop Battery Longevity
Charge limit: Many laptops allow setting a charge limit of 80%. Lenovo (Conservation Mode), ASUS (Battery Health Charging), and Apple (Optimized Battery Charging) all offer this. Keeping the battery between 20-80% significantly extends its lifespan.
Avoid extreme temperatures: Heat is the primary enemy of lithium batteries. Do not leave laptops in hot cars, and avoid using the laptop on soft surfaces (bed, couch) that block ventilation.
Calibrate monthly: Once per month, let the battery drain to 10-15%, then charge to 100% without interruption. This calibrates the battery gauge for accurate percentage reporting.
Smart Device Battery Tips
Earbuds: Store in the charging case when not in use. Most cases maintain earbuds at optimal charge levels automatically. Replace ear tips that do not seal — a poor seal means you turn the volume up, which drains the battery faster.
Smartwatch: Reduce screen-on time. Use a simpler watch face (fewer complications and animations = less power). Disable always-on display if battery life is a concern.
Bluetooth speakers: Charge before the battery drops below 20%. Deep discharges are harder on batteries than partial discharges. Store partially charged (40-60%) for extended periods.
The Environmental Impact
If every smartphone user extended their battery lifespan by one year (from an average 2.5 to 3.5 years of use), it would prevent approximately 200 million phones from being manufactured, saving the energy and materials embedded in their production. Battery optimization at scale has a meaningful environmental impact.
